ubuntu 生成公钥_ubuntu系统使用SSH免密码登陆

将Client端的公钥添加到用于认证的Server端的公钥文件中

首先检查Server端需要认证的phenix用户的家目录下,隐藏目录“ssh”目录下是否存在一个名为“authorized_keys”的文件,

若不存在,使用命令:touch authorized_keys 创建一个空文件

创建完成后,则可以执行如下步骤:

执行步骤如下:

1,将Clinet端公钥的内容复制

2,将复制到的Client端公钥内容,粘贴至Server端刚才创建的 authorized_keys 文件中,保存文件。

3,更改 authorized_keys 文件的权限

执行命令:chmod 600  authorized_keys

Client公钥内容格式大概如下:

ssh-rsa AAAAB3NzaC1yc2EAAAADAQABAAABAQCzKGjCrHNCPCT96TTl8j1UtJ10V9a3fLIdx6R0upKP2N7FJP82Nni/vmAx7UVDhUNCgyfyG5Y6wK8AK2hOGjKLfLdfyYPojwmx3MF8KTspZBmmYKbHWh6Aem4TskRmsHOSpWeqns7o3tle0Ln1GMmPpdFph/owa7vj5/JYSOCBX8c+gGFyJeAMHGTs1fnHhGZRl5mzu8mWIv+qJnDxRmE/jBtuNXzSrPeZ2Cz86U+DfWtXVRyEl9XoIotX+GZ/zPxvPoMoItWD3UL6aA8McCX/PE7BLFA4B1Nl+mefTVpHH39AqcyqkcAJxntoqeNU3IwaM7sx/J7ONrFxp9Z3fjVR phenix@Client

实例公私钥截图如下:


版权声明:本文为weixin_39829574原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接和本声明。